2. Establish Trust and Credibility
Did you know that establishing trust is the first step to getting customers to engage with you online? In marketing, it’s called the “know, like, and trust factor”. It ultimately helps potential clients to see you as an expert in your field which makes it easier for them to book with you.
Your website can be a powerful tool for achieving this. By including client testimonials, showcasing your portfolio of successful projects, and displaying your accreditations and certifications, you can demonstrate your expertise and showcase your commitment to sustainable design practices.
Furthermore, ensuring that your website is secure and easy to use can help instill confidence in potential clients and encourage them to reach out.
3. Generate More Leads and Conversions
Think about the goals you want to achieve for your website. Ultimately, for eco-interior designers, the most important function of a website is to attract new clients and generate more business, so getting clients on discovery calls should be one of the main goals.
By incorporating and implementing web design strategies that tailor to this outcome, you can increase your chances of achieving this goal.
For instance, by optimizing your website for search engines and including clear calls-to-action, you can attract more organic traffic and encourage visitors to take action, whether that's filling out a contact form, signing up for a newsletter, or scheduling a consultation.
Additionally, by utilizing social media integration and email marketing, you can create a multi-channel approach to lead generation and increase your chances of converting visitors into paying clients.
